Most Searched Colleges In Texas Financial Aid Comparison

In average, 85%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at Most Searched Colleges In Texas. The average financial aid amount received is $11,857.
For all undergraduate students, 75.67%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$11,808
The 2024 average tuition & fees for the schools is $9,460 for state residents and $28,871 for out-of-state students.
The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for Most Searched Colleges In Texas is $46,709 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$34,852.
